I can't seem to get the four ways or the turn signals to work on my Jinma. They all worked up until a month ago. I have replaced the Flasher twice. Could there be a problem with the voltage regulator ? one of the wires actually go up to the Voltage Regulator. I ran a seperate ground wire from the flasher up to the Voltage reg and the blinkers started working but it blew the fuse after about 5 seconds. at this point i am confused.

It could be a short somewhere in your wires. Look along the wires for one being pinched and the insulation being cut just enough to blow the fuse. Could even be in the switch or a bulb socket. kt ....

I was unaware that Jinmas had four way flashers. Please clarify. To have both directional signals AND four way flashers, you need TWO relays. Flashers typically use a two prong relay, directional signals a three prong.

LW, I am going to assume you have the one peice dash?.
The horn relay has four prongs.
The Turn signal flasher has 3 prongs. Both your turn signals and hazards use the same flasher and is not your typical 3 prong flasher... FACTORY PART.
The wire I think your are taliking about is black... if so ??... it is a ground.

Ron that is exactly what i have. since i repaired the black ground wire all the blinkers started working but it is almost like there is a dead short somewhere as after about four blinks it blows the fuse. while it is blinking the alternator gauge is showing a huge discharge. I have ordered a new voltage regulator i think the problem is in there as it seems to share itself with the flasher.
